From KFCoder✅️
| 项目 | 内容 |
|---|---|
| 这个作业属于哪个课程 | ->点我进入课程主页 |
| 这个作业要求在哪里 | ->点我查看作业要求 |
Alpha阶段项目复审
| 小组的名字和链接 | 优点 | 缺点(bug报告) | 最终名次(无并列) |
|---|---|---|---|
| 大学生健康管理与预警系统 | 1. 测试覆盖全面,307个测试用例执行率100% 2. Bug管理规范,19个已修复Bug分类明确 3. 场景设计合理,覆盖三类用户 4. 出口条件量化明确 5. 文档完整,部署指南清晰 |
具体Bug:食物识别结果偶尔不准确(归为"无法修复"),数据统计接口大数据量响应慢。 项目目标实现:基本实现了健康管理与预警核心功能,但AI识别准确率问题影响核心体验。 风险应对:对技术风险(如AI模型依赖)应对不足,缺乏降级策略;性能风险延期处理。 用户痛点解决:解决了学生便捷记录、预警提醒等痛点,但校医院端数据辅助决策功能较薄弱。 需求取舍:优先实现了核心健康记录与预警,但多语言支持、离线模式等次要需求延期。 源代码管理:GitHub仓库明确,但未提及分支策略、代码审查等具体实践。 领导改进:我会将AI识别准确率问题列为高优先级,探索模型优化或人工校准;加强性能优化前移;建立更完善的外部服务熔断机制。 |
1 |
| 场馆预约系统 | 1. 测试用例设计详尽,覆盖全流程 2. 性能与安全测试到位 3. Bug管理透明,分类清晰 4. 多角色场景覆盖合理 5. 出口条件量化合理 |
具体Bug:邮件通知格式异常、状态刷新延迟、管理端筛选性能低等5个Bug延期。 项目目标实现:实现了场馆预约核心流程,但实时状态同步的稳定性有待验证。 风险应对:对网络波动导致的实时同步问题缺乏补偿机制,兼容性风险处理滞后。 用户痛点解决:解决了学生找场馆难的痛点,但社团多人协同预约功能体验可优化。 需求取舍:优先保证预约流程完整,但管理端效率优化、移动端深度适配等需求被后置。 源代码管理:部署文档详细,但未提供代码仓库链接,无法评估代码管理质量。 领导改进:我会将实时同步的稳定性作为技术攻关重点;提前进行多浏览器兼容性测试;提供项目代码仓库以增强透明度。 |
2 |
| NoteForces在线笔记系统 | 1. 测试报告结构完整:包含测试目的、范围、过程、Bug统计、场景测试、测试矩阵、出口条件 2. Bug分类管理规范:15个Bug按5类清晰分类,修复了9个关键Bug 3. 场景设计合理:覆盖普通学生、教师/小组、管理员三类用户 4. 部署文档详细:提供前后端完整的部署步骤 5. 提供了GitHub仓库:代码可查看,有Alpha版本tag |
具体Bug:重复用户名未校验、登录状态码不统一、Markdown渲染异常、删除后列表不同步、分享链接缓存未清理等9个Bug已修复;分享链接无过期时间延期修复;并发编辑内容覆盖问题无法修复。 项目目标实现:实现了在线笔记核心功能(CRUD、Markdown、分享、管理),但协同编辑能力有限。 风险应对:对并发编辑风险识别但无解决方案(无法修复),对分享链接安全风险延期处理。 用户痛点解决:解决了学生记录笔记、分享协作的痛点,但实时协同编辑能力弱是硬伤。 需求取舍:优先保证单用户笔记流程完整,但多人实时协作、分享链接安全控制等需求被后置或放弃。 源代码管理:GitHub仓库明确,有版本tag,但未提及分支策略、代码审查等实践。 领导改进:我会引入简单的锁机制防止并发编辑冲突;将分享链接过期时间作为Alpha版本必须功能;加强单元测试和集成测试覆盖。 |
3 |
| 在线考试系统 | 1. 测试报告结构完整,逻辑清晰 2. Bug分类细致,管理规范 3. 场景覆盖全面,贴近真实 4. 性能指标明确,可衡量 5. 部署文档详细,易操作 |
具体Bug:考试倒计时误差(浏览器最小化后>30秒)、复杂公式导出格式丢失等Bug延期。 项目目标实现:实现了在线考试全流程,但倒计时精度问题直接影响考试公平性。 风险应对:对客户端环境差异(如浏览器最小化行为)风险预估不足,应对方案延期。 用户痛点解决:解决了线下考试组织难的痛点,但教师组卷的智能推荐、防作弊深度检测等高级需求未满足。 需求取舍:核心考试流程优先,但用户体验细节(如移动端适配、导出功能完善)有所牺牲。 源代码管理:未提供代码仓库链接,无法评估版本控制、持续集成等实践。 领导改进:我会将考试倒计时精度问题列为阻塞性Bug立即解决;加强安全性渗透测试;建立公开的代码仓库并实施每日构建。 |
4 |
| 本地知识库问答系统 | 1. 架构清晰,技术选型合理 2. 测试阶段划分明确 3. Bug管理有序,延期说明合理 4. 部署友好,Docker一键启动 5. 场景设计贴近实际 |
具体Bug:长PDF解析内存占用高、低配GPU响应慢、Safari流式输出不连贯。 项目目标实现:实现了本地知识库问答的核心RAG流程,但处理大文件和多格式文档能力有限。 风险应对:对资源消耗(内存、GPU)的风险有认知但解决方案延期,性能优化不足。 用户痛点解决:解决了隐私安全与本地化查询痛点,但处理复杂、非结构化文档的能力较弱。 需求取舍:优先保证了核心问答链路,但文件格式支持、多模态问答等扩展需求被搁置。 源代码管理:提及GitHub但未在博客突出链接,部署方式现代化但代码工程实践描述少。 领导改进:我会引入更高效的分块与缓存策略应对大文件;提供轻量级模型选项适应低配环境;建立更详细的单元测试与性能基准测试。 |
5 |
| 云盘协作系统 | 1. 测试策略先进(测试左移) 2. Bug分类清晰,修复计划明确 3. 性能测试贴近实际(50人并发) 4. 部署文档完整 5. 安全机制考虑到位 |
具体Bug:断点续传未实现、移动端未适配、分享链接仅限本地访问。 项目目标实现:实现了文件上传分享基础功能,但核心体验功能(断点续传)缺失。 风险应对:对移动化趋势和网络不稳定场景的风险应对不足,功能规划略显保守。 用户痛点解决:解决了团队文件共享痛点,但大文件传输可靠性、跨平台访问便捷性体验差。 需求取舍:优先实现了基础文件管理,但提升用户体验的关键功能(断点续传、移动端)被延迟。 源代码管理:GitHub仓库地址未突出显示,缺乏对代码质量、构建流水线的描述。 领导改进:我会采用分片上传与断点续传技术作为Alpha版本核心目标之一;同步启动移动端响应式设计;将服务部署到内网或云服务器以供真实测试。 |
6 |
| eSIM全球数据套餐购买网站 | 1. 响应式设计完善:覆盖桌面、平板、移动三端,考虑了不同设备体验 2. 缺陷修复记录详细:列出了8个已修复缺陷及其影响和状态 3. 浏览器兼容性考虑周全:提供了各浏览器的最低和推荐版本 4. 部署简单:纯前端网站,无需复杂安装 5. 提供了公网访问地址:可直接体验 |
具体Bug:移动端菜单栏在iOS Safari中无法展开、套餐卡片阴影在暗色模式不可见、首页图片加载慢、平板文字大小不一致、按钮无视觉反馈、Edge浏览器布局错位、部分文字缺失翻译、按钮颜色对比度不符合WCAG标准等8个Bug已修复。 项目目标实现:实现了eSIM套餐展示网站的核心功能,但本质上是一个前端展示型网站,业务逻辑简单。 风险应对:对前端兼容性和性能问题有一定应对,但缺乏后端和业务逻辑的风险管理。 用户痛点解决:解决了用户了解eSIM套餐信息的痛点,但购买、支付、激活等核心交易流程未实现。 需求取舍:优先保证前端展示和响应式设计,但电商核心功能(用户账户、支付、订单管理)完全缺失。 源代码管理:未提供代码仓库信息,无法评估代码质量和版本管理实践。 领导改进:我会在Alpha版本至少实现模拟购买流程,哪怕只是前端交互;建立完整的测试用例,而不仅仅是修复缺陷列表;提供项目代码仓库以增强透明度。 |
7 |
| 图书管理系统 | 1. 测试报告结构规范,覆盖全面 2. Bug管理透明,修复率75% 3. 提供具体测试用例,可信度高 4. 部署说明清晰 5. 场景设计合理 |
具体Bug:Safari图表渲染异常、大数据分页跳转慢等Bug延期。 项目目标实现:实现了图书借阅管理核心功能,但系统性能和数据可视化细节有待优化。 风险应对:对兼容性和性能风险有记录但修复滞后,缺乏前瞻性性能优化设计。 用户痛点解决:解决了手工管理图书的低效痛点,但读者个性化推荐、移动端便捷查询等增值服务未涉及。 需求取舍:优先满足管理员后台管理需求,但前端用户体验和高级统计功能作为次要需求后置。 源代码管理:未提供代码仓库或CI/CD信息,难以评估团队协作和代码维护水平。 领导改进:我会在项目早期定义更严格的兼容性测试矩阵;对大数据操作引入分页优化和索引优化;推动代码仓库公开和自动化测试覆盖。 |
8 |
| iBlog Community | 1. 测试计划详细,分阶段明确 2. Bug分类合理 3. 出口条件量化 4. 部署步骤清晰 5. 场景覆盖典型用户 |
具体Bug:私信同步延迟、搜索长尾词不精准等Bug延期。 项目目标实现:实现了博客社区核心创作与互动功能,但搜索体验和实时交互有缺陷。 风险应对:对技术复杂度较高的实时消息和搜索功能风险应对不足,采取了延期策略。 用户痛点解决:解决了技术博客写作与分享的痛点,但内容发现效率和读者互动即时性有待提升。 需求取舍:优先保证博客发布、评论基础功能,但社交深度功能(实时聊天、智能搜索)被划为次要。 源代码管理:GitHub地址在文中提及但不突出,未提及分支模型、提交规范等具体实践。 领导改进:我会采用Elasticsearch等方案提升搜索质量;对实时功能采用WebSocket并做好降级;强化代码审查和自动化部署流程。 |
9 |
| 校园点评系统 | 1. 测试范围明确,Bug分类详细 2. 场景设计区分用户角色 3. 测试矩阵覆盖广泛 4. 出口条件多维度定义 5. 提供公网地址,可体验 |
具体Bug:优惠券秒杀并发超卖、搜索性能差、短信验证失败、关注数据同步延迟。 项目目标实现:实现了点评平台基础功能,但核心交易与搜索功能存在严重Bug和性能问题。 风险应对:对高并发场景和第三方服务集成风险准备不足,关键Bug修复延期影响大。 用户痛点解决:试图解决校园消费信息不对称痛点,但系统稳定性和功能可靠性成为新痛点。 需求取舍:功能范围铺得较广,但深度不足,许多功能(如多语言、离线模式)在基础不牢时即规划。 源代码管理:未提供任何代码仓库或构建信息,项目管理透明度低。 领导改进:我会收缩Alpha版本范围,聚焦核心点评与浏览流程的稳定性;引入压力测试和数据库锁机制解决并发问题;建立公开的代码库和问题跟踪系统。 |
10 |
| 智能消费分析工具 | 1. 测试报告结构清晰 2. Bug分类规范 3. 出口条件量化,评估客观 4. 提供改进路线图 5. 部署简单,用户体验门槛低 |
具体Bug:大文件处理超时(10MB需45秒)、Safari图表显示兼容性问题、PDF格式不支持。 项目目标实现:实现了CSV解析与消费可视化基本功能,但处理能力和文件格式支持有限。 风险应对:对性能瓶颈和浏览器兼容性风险应对较被动,优化工作列入中长期计划。 用户痛点解决:解决了个人消费分析手工处理的痛点,但数据导入的便捷性和分析深度不足。 需求取舍:优先实现了前端展示与交互,但后端持久化、多格式支持等支撑性需求被完全后置。 源代码管理:项目为纯前端Mock,无后端代码管理可言,缺乏完整的软件工程生命周期管理。 领导改进:我会在Alpha版本设计简易的后端服务用于数据持久化;优化CSV解析算法并使用Web Worker防止界面卡顿;制定清晰的版本迭代计划,而不是将所有优化推后。 |
11 |
| 校园二手书交易平台 | 1. 测试报告结构完整 2. Bug管理基本规范 3. 部署简单,基于Django 4. 场景设计合理 5. 提供GitHub地址 |
具体Bug:首页分页异常、发布成功提示不显示、后台修改后缓存未更新等基础功能问题。 项目目标实现:实现了二手书信息发布与展示的基本功能,但系统健壮性和用户体验一般。 风险应对:对常见Web开发问题(如缓存、分页)的风险预估和预防不足,Bug多为基础性问题。 用户痛点解决:解决了信息发布渠道少的痛点,但信息匹配效率、交易信任机制等核心痛点未触及。 需求取舍:实现了最小可行产品(MVP),但未看到对搜索优化、用户信誉体系等后续需求的明确规划。 源代码管理:有GitHub仓库,但未提及团队协作方式、提交频率或代码质量管控措施。 领导改进:我会在开发前制定更详细的前后端接口契约;引入自动化测试覆盖核心流程;加强代码审查,避免出现分页、缓存等低级Bug。 |
12 |
| TanhT文章管理系统 | 1. 测试报告结构清晰 2. 部署极其简单,纯前端 3. 提供GitHub发布地址 4. 场景设计合理 5. 出口条件明确 |
具体Bug:数据非持久化、无真实后端逻辑、无法多用户协同,严格说这更多是系统缺陷而非Bug。 项目目标实现:仅实现了一个前端演示原型,未达到可实际使用的"系统"目标。 风险应对:选择纯Mock方案规避了后端开发风险,但也导致项目实用性为零,风险应对策略消极。 用户痛点解决:未能解决任何真实的内容管理痛点,因为数据无法保存和共享。 需求取舍:所有与后端交互、数据持久化、用户权限等真实需求都被舍弃,项目价值有限。 源代码管理:仅有前端代码仓库,项目结构不完整,无法体现全栈开发的工程能力。 领导改进:我会坚持在Alpha版本实现一个简单的后端服务(如Node.js + SQLite),确保数据持久化和基本的用户验证,哪怕功能简单,也要形成一个完整的、可运行的软件,而不是一个演示玩具。 |
13 |
| 天空外卖系统 | 1. 测试报告结构完整 2. Bug分类详细 3. 部署文档极其详细 4. 测试矩阵覆盖较广 5. 场景设计合理 |
具体Bug:订单状态异常、购物车同步问题、优惠券计算错误、WebSocket偶发断连。 项目目标实现:实现了外卖系统的基本框架,但核心业务逻辑存在多处Bug,稳定性存疑。 风险应对:对业务逻辑复杂性和实时通信稳定性风险应对不足,Bug修复率仅68%,接近达标线。 用户痛点解决:试图模仿成熟外卖平台,但自有创新点不明确,且基础功能问题影响解决痛点的有效性。 需求取舍:功能大而全,但许多功能完成质量不高,可能应优先打磨核心下单支付流程的鲁棒性。 源代码管理:未提供代码仓库,虽然部署步骤详细,但无法考察代码质量和团队协作过程。 领导改进:我会大幅精简Alpha版本范围,专注打磨"选餐-下单-模拟支付"单一路径的完美体验;建立功能优先级机制,先做精再做大;强制要求代码托管并制定提交规范。 |
14 |
| 论坛系统 | 1. 部署简单,提供可执行文件 2. 基本功能完整 3. 提供测试账号 4. 运行环境要求明确 |
具体Bug:后端代码未解耦、无管理员功能、不能发布图片、不能@、登录过期机制不完善等,实为大量功能缺失与设计缺陷。 项目目标实现:仅实现了论坛最基础的发帖回帖功能,距离一个可用的论坛系统差距甚大。 风险应对:几乎未进行任何风险识别与应对规划,项目在架构、安全、功能上均存在高风险问题。 用户痛点解决:仅解决了匿名发言的初级需求,在内容管理、互动体验、安全保障等核心痛点上均未解决。 需求取舍:在未完成核心功能稳定性和安全性的情况下,开发了次要功能(如按年级筛选),需求取舍本末倒置。 源代码管理:后端代码"未解耦,维护性较差",是源代码管理实践缺失的直接体现。 领导改进:我会彻底重构项目,采用分层架构;将用户认证与授权、内容安全过滤、图片上传作为Alpha版本必须完成的核心需求;建立严格的代码规范并进行每日代码审查。 |
15 |